A clear, thoughtful look at the Book of Revelation and what it means for readers today. This scholarly essay reconsiders classic interpretations, arguing for a spiritual rather than strictly literal reading of the Apocalypse. It places the visions in their historical context and explains how hope, not fear, can shape our understanding of prophecy.

In this concise study, the author weighs how early Christian readers faced persecution under Rome and why that context matters for interpretation. The discussion traces the symbolic language, the role of Nero and the beast, and how the book’s dramatic imagery can inspire faith without locking into one fixed timetable or sequence.
